Vest Financial LLC boosted its position in Albemarle Corporation (NYSE:ALB - Free Report) by 55.4% during the 2nd qu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 959,978 shares of the specialty chemicals company's stock after purchasing an additional 342,321 shares during the quarter. Albemarle comprises 0.9% of Vest Financial LLC's holdings, making the stock its 26th biggest position. Vest Financial LLC owned approximately 0.82% of Albemarle worth $60,162,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Albemarle Stock Performance
Shares of ALB opened at $90.04 on Monday. The firm's 50 day moving average is $81.38 and its 200-day moving average is $69.25. The stock has a market capitalization of $10.60 billion, a P/E ratio of -9.66 and a beta of 1.65.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.38, a current ratio of 2.31 and a quick ratio of 1.47. Albemarle Corporation has a 12-month low of $49.43 and a 12-month high of $113.91.
Albemarle (NYSE:ALB -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, July 30th. The specialty chemicals company reported $0.11 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of ($0.83) by $0.94. The company had revenue of $1.33 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.23 billion. Albemarle had a negative net margin of 18.61% and a negative return on equity of 1.87%. The business's revenue was down 7.0%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ted $0.04 EPS. Albemarle has set its FY 2025 guidance at EPS. Equities research analysts anticipate that Albemarle Corporation will post -0.04 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Albemarle Announces Dividend
The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, October 1st. Stockholders of record on Friday, September 12th were issued a dividend of $0.405 per share. The ex-dividend date was Friday, September 12th. This represents a $1.62 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.8%. Albemarle's payout ratio is currently -17.38%.

About Albemarle
(
Free Report)
Albemarle Corporation develops, manufactures, and markets engineered specialty chemicals worldwide. It operates through three segments: Energy Storage, Specialties and Ketjen. The Energy Storage segment offers lithium compounds, including lithium carbonate, lithium hydroxide, and lithium chloride; technical services for the handling and use of reactive lithium products; and lithium-containing by-products recycling services.
